Understanding the Fundamentals of Agricultural Scales



Industrial ScalesIndustrial Scales
In the huge world of modern farming, the function of agricultural scales is pivotal. These tools offer as the foundation of farming operations, promoting the considering of produce, livestock, and basic materials. Agricultural ranges come in different types, from simple mechanical tools to advanced digital scales, each created to meet specific requirements in the farming market.


These ranges play a significant part in figuring out the productivity of a ranch. They aid farmers monitor the weight of their livestock or crops, vital information that affect rates and advertising and marketing approaches. Moreover, they assist in tracking feed consumption, which is vital for managing costs and ensuring animals' wellness.


Furthermore, farming ranges are critical for conformity with laws. Lots of countries have stringent policies about the weight of agricultural items, and precise weighing is important to prevent charges.

Accuracy Considering Benefits



Precision weighing systems have reinvented contemporary farming, using a myriad of benefits that boost efficiency and productivity. These scales give farmers with exact measurements for seed and fertilizer applications, guaranteeing optimal development problems and reducing waste. Precise weight details likewise allows for better control over livestock feed, cultivating this website healthier pets and enhanced product quality. Accuracy ranges aid in the accurate measurement of yield, allowing farmers to make informed choices concerning plant rotation and marketing. Making use of such modern technology also reduces the threat of straining automobiles, boosting security and reducing wear and tear.
